Output a65912cc8d2873193ec7feb5aee770c8422fefa4c5b553324310c413abed1ea9: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b8595e6312c3d8a7376aadb12353332c882538 OP_EQUAL
address
3Cc3BAtgDgChfeMmXZiM3VZ12NWdrPR2n1
transaction
a65912cc8d2873193ec7feb5aee770c8422fefa4c5b553324310c413abed1ea9
confirmations
452500
spent
true